1. Which dopaminergic pathway is primarily associated with the positive symptoms of

schizophrenia, such as hallucinations and delusions?

A. Mesolimbic pathway


B. Mesocortical pathway


C. Nigrostriatal pathway


D. Tuberoinfundibular pathway


Answer: A


Conceptual Explanation: The mesolimbic pathway involves the projection from the

ventral tegmental area to the nucleus accumbens; overactivity here is linked to positive

symptoms.


2. A patient on Clozapine shows an Absolute Neutrophil Count (ANC) of 900/mm³. What is the

most appropriate next step?

A. Continue the medication but monitor weekly


B. Switch to Olanzapine immediately without tapering

,C. Increase the dose to compensate for marrow suppression


D. Interrupt treatment and consult hematology


Answer: D


Conceptual Explanation: An ANC below 1000/mm³ (moderate neutropenia) requires

interruption of Clozapine therapy and hematological consultation to prevent

agranulocytosis.


3. Which neurotransmitter system is the primary target for Benzodiazepines to exert their

anxiolytic effect?

A. Glutamate via NMDA receptors


B. Dopamine via D2 receptors


C. GABA via GABA-A receptors


D. Serotonin via 5-HT1A receptors


Answer: C


Conceptual Explanation: Benzodiazepines act as positive allosteric modulators at the

GABA-A receptor, increasing the frequency of chloride channel opening.


4. A 24-year-old female experiences at least 4 days of abnormally elevated mood, increased

energy, and decreased need for sleep, but her functioning is not severely impaired and there

are no psychotic features. What is the diagnosis?

A. Bipolar I Disorder

, B. Major Depressive Disorder


C. Bipolar II Disorder


D. Cyclothymic Disorder


Answer: C


Conceptual Explanation: Bipolar II requires a history of at least one hypomanic episode

(lasting 4 days, no psychosis/hospitalization) and one major depressive episode.


5. Which medication is most likely to cause Stevens-Johnson Syndrome (SJS) if not titrated

slowly?

A. Lithium


B. Valproate


C. Quetiapine


D. Lamotrigine


Answer: D


Conceptual Explanation: Lamotrigine carries a black box warning for serious rashes,

including SJS, which is mitigated by a very slow dose titration schedule.
